Why September Is the Best Month for Vacation in Crete: Everything You Need to Know

Looking for the perfect time to visit Crete? September might just be the island’s best- kept secret. With sunny skies, average temperatures around 27°C, and sea waters still delightfully warm at 24–26°C, the weather is just right - not too hot, not too cool. Unlike the crowded chaos of August, September in Crete offers a more relaxed experience: iconic sites like Knossos Palace and Samaria Gorge are quieter, making exploration more enjoyable. Plus, it's easier on your wallet. As the high season fades, prices for flights, hotels, and car rentals drop, giving you better value without sacrificing the magic. Let’s explore why September is the best month to plan your Crete getaway.
